Procharger Oil Change
Question for people with Self Contained Prochargers,
I just did my first oil change on a new M1-SC after about 9 hours. I was surprised to see what appeared to be fine metallic particles suspended in the oil. Has anyone taken a close look at the oil from an initial oil change on an SC unit? I am debating contacting ATI and inquiring but I thought I'd post a thread. I put fresh oil in it and ran it and plan to do another oil change in 20 hours or so. thanks if you have any information. paul |
If they were very fine shavings, don't worry about it. That's just the gears developing a wear pattern.
If they were large shavings then that would be a different story. By the next oil change there should be less. There will be some due to what was left in the casing. However, after a couple of more changes they should just about disappear. DAVE |
